AUSTRALIAN WAR MEMORIAL ACT 1980 - SECT 4
Incorporation of Memorial
- (1)
- There is established by this section a corporation by the name of the
Australian War Memorial.
- (2)
- The Memorial:
- (a)
- has perpetual succession;
- (b)
- shall have a common seal;
- (c)
- may acquire,
hold and dispose of real and personal property; and
- (d)
- may sue and be sued
in its corporate name.
Note: The
Commonwealth Authorities and Companies Act 1997 applies to the Memorial. That
Act deals with matters relating to Commonwealth authorities, including
reporting and accountability, banking and investment, and conduct of officers.
- (3)
- The common seal of the Memorial shall be kept in such custody as the
Council directs and shall not be used except as authorized by the Council.
- (4)
- All courts, judges and persons acting judicially shall take judical notice
of the common seal of the Memorial affixed to a document and shall presume
that it was duly affixed.
